Transaction 81ab14ec320afc878ba2d962c73ed39ec868dc1b76ff5ada79f249b8db7aef5f
1 Input
1 Output
-
81ab14ec320afc878ba2d962c73ed39ec868dc1b76ff5ada79f249b8db7aef5f:0
- value
- 313324
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7cfcdf5dd4cc160f0cc2a470bc5933c94c0558ba OP_EQUAL
- address
- 3D5teDpT7jKXR3rZPySEzUExuTbMaB9ZiA